Lady Amelia Windsor proved she could do casual cool today as she oozed winter chic in cosy clashing prints for a night out in London.   

Amelia, 26, who is 43rd in the line of succession to the British throne, showcased her fashion prowess in the Shrimps ‘Shrimpsmas’ Party at The George.

The royal opted for a faux fur leopard print jacket with statement blue trimming which she paired with a maxi green skirt in a white polka dot print.

Effortlessly working clashing prints, she added a multicoloured skirt and gold chains to the look.

Going for a full maximalist look, the granddaughter of the Duke of Kent – and third cousin of Princes William and Harry – added a handful of golden rings to the outfit and a brash gold chain.

The party girl has featured on the front of Tatler magazine and is also a regular at London Fashion Week, having first come to prominence at the Queen’s 90th birthday party in 2016.

Once dubbed the most beautiful member of the royal family, Lady Amelia is currently signed to Storm models, which represents the likes of Kate Moss and Cara Delevingne.

Lady Amelia has also modelled for the likes of Dolce & Gabbana and designed her own range of accessories in collaboration with Penelope Chilvers.

The contributing editor to Tatler Magazine, she also reportedly interned at jewellery house Bulgari during her time studying at Edinburgh University.
